Responsibilities:
- Set up exam venues with required materials following strict procedures
- Ensure the fair and proper conduct of examinations in an environment that enables a student to perform at their best
- Closely follow and enforce exam procedures and regulations
- Assist candidates prior to the start of examinations by directing them to their seats and advising them about possessions permitted in examination venues
- Ensure that candidates do not talk once inside examination venues
- Invigilate during examinations, deal with queries raised by candidates and address examination irregularities in accordance with procedures
- Check attendance during examinations
